Buying a Black 4 Seater Leather Sofa

There are a few aspects you need to consider when purchasing a black sofa. Make sure it's a good fit in your space. A sofa that is too large can make your space feel crowded and overwhelming.


Think about the hue of your carpets, rugs, and walls. Sofas with black upholstery work well with neutral colors as well as light wall colors and patterns on rugs.

It's Versatile

A black sofa is stunning in a range of colors. It is stunning when set with white. However it can also be paired with peach or grey tones, brown, cream or earthy tones. Since it's a dark shade, it's best not to place a couch in black in direct sunlight for prolonged periods of time, as prolonged exposure could cause the fabric to fade over time. You might want to consider placing an area rug that is large in front of your sofa when you have a lot of windows in your living area. This will help absorb some of the sunlight.

A quality leather sofa is a great feature for any home. Its durability and beautiful design make it a timeless piece of design, even after a number of years of use. In fact, as it gets older it often develops a gorgeous patina which enhances its appearance.

A black 4 seater leather sofa is also extremely comfortable. Leather sofas are incredibly flexible and soft, as opposed to fabrics which can feel squishy after a long time of sitting. This makes it ideal for those who like to lounge and relax on their sofas.

It is important to carefully consider your options when you are choosing a sofa. It is important to consider how you'll use it as well as whether you have children or pets, and what your budget. It's also a good idea to try out multiple sofas to see how they will fit into your living space and how comfortable they are.

Consider the color and texture of a leather sofa to ensure it is in line with your interior. There are various types of leather - from full grain to bonded or faux. The type of leather you select will determine how long the sofa will last and whether it will begin to show signs of wear.

Leather sofas should be well-maintained to prevent fading or cracking over time However, you don't have to spend a lot of cash to keep yours looking brand new. To keep your furniture looking good you just need to clean it up regularly and clean it with commercial or distilled leather cleaner. To extend the life of your leather, purchase a leather conditioner that will help restore the oils in your leather.

Another method to extend the longevity of your leather sofa is by choosing darker shades like black. Lighter shades are more prone to fading in time, particularly if exposed to direct sunlight for prolonged periods of time. They have durable wood frames, which are usually kiln-dried or engineered wood. Some manufacturers use metal for the frames however, they are less durable and robust than a wooden frame.

If you are looking for a 4 seater leather sofa, search for models made from full-grain or top-grain leather. These kinds of leather are more durable and more durable than split-grain leather which is less expensive, but it may not hold its shape in the same way over time. Avoid faux leather sofas made of polyurethane because they don't feel the same as real leather.

Keep in mind that while leather is easy to clean and durable, it's temperature-sensitive. It's prone to drying out in direct sunlight and turn hot to the touch, so it's recommended to put your couch in a shaded area or put it under a light-colored throw blanket.
